Prvo izdanje besplatne PaaS platforme Cozystack bazirane na Kubernetesu

Objavljeno je prvo izdanje Cozystack PaaS platforme otvorenog koda, zasnovane na Kubernetes-u. Projekat se pozicionira kao spremna platforma za hosting provajdere i okvir za izgradnju privatnih i javnih oblaka. Platforma se instalira direktno na servere i pokriva sve aspekte pripreme infrastrukture za pružanje upravljanih usluga. Cozystack vam omogućava pokretanje i obezbjeđivanje Kubernetes klastera, baza podataka i drugih usluga na zahtjev. virtuelna mašinaKod platforme je dostupan na GitHub-u i distribuira se pod Apache-2.0 licencom.

Prvo izdanje besplatne PaaS platforme Cozystack bazirane na Kubernetesu

Talos Linux i Flux CD se koriste kao osnovni tehnološki stog. Slike sa sistemom, kernelom i potrebnim modulima se generišu unapred i ažuriraju atomski, što vam omogućava da bez komponenti kao što su dkms i menadžer paketa i garantuje stabilan rad.

Za početak virtuelne mašine Koristi se KubeVirt tehnologija koja omogućava pokretanje klasičnih virtuelnih mašina direktno u Kubernetes kontejnerima i već ima sve potrebne integracije sa Cluster API-jem za pokretanje upravljanih Kubernetes klastera unutar hardverskog Kubernetes klastera.

Platforma uključuje besplatnu implementaciju mrežne fabrike bazirane na Kube-OVN, i koristi Cilium za organizaciju servisne mreže, MetalLB za oglašavanje usluga prema van. Skladištenje je implementirano na LINSTOR-u, koji predlaže korištenje ZFS-a kao osnovnog sloja za skladištenje i DRBD-a za replikaciju. Postoji unapred konfigurisani stek za praćenje zasnovan na VictoriaMetrics i Grafani.

Jedna od ključnih značajki platforme je jednostavna metoda instalacije u prazan podatkovni centar koristeći PXE i talos-bootstrap instalater sličan Debianu. Uprkos komercijalnom interesu, projekat razvijaju entuzijasti iz zajednice i planira da uvek ostane besplatan. Poslan je zahtjev za prijenos Cozystacka pod okrilje organizacije CNCF (Cloud Native Computing Foundation).

izvor: opennet.ru

Dodajte komentar